How Does the Pikachu App Compare to Other Streaming Apps?

How Does The Pikachu App Compare To Other Streaming Apps?

The Pikachu App is a streaming platform that offers a variety of content, from movies and TV shows to live sports and music. It is known for its easy-to-use interface and diverse selection of content that appeals to a broad audience. The Pikachu App is available on multiple devices, including smartphones, tablets, and smart TVs, making it convenient for users to watch their favorite content anytime, anywhere.

What Other Streaming Apps Are We Comparing It With?

There are many streaming services available today, but some of the most popular include:

  • Netflix: Known for its massive library of original and licensed content.
  • Amazon Prime Video: Offers a wide variety of movies, TV shows, and exclusive Amazon Originals.
  • Hulu: Famous for its TV show collection, including next-day access to popular shows.
  • Disney+: Home to Disney, Marvel, Star Wars, Pixar, and National Geographic content.

These services are some of the biggest players in the streaming industry. Let’s now compare the Pikachu App with each of these services.

1. Content Library

One of the most important factors when choosing a streaming app is the variety and quality of content available. The Pikachu App offers a broad range of options, including movies, TV shows, and live sports. However, its content library might not be as extensive as Netflix or Amazon Prime Video. Let’s look at how the Pikachu App compares to other services:

Pikachu App: The app provides a mix of different genres, including action, comedy, drama, and romance. It also offers some live TV channels, which is a bonus for users who enjoy sports and news.

Netflix: Netflix is well-known for its vast library of original content, including award-winning movies and TV series like "Stranger Things" and "The Witcher." The selection is constantly updated, making it one of the best options for those looking for variety.

Amazon Prime Video: Amazon offers a huge collection of movies, TV shows, and Amazon Originals like "The Boys" and "Jack Ryan." The app is also known for its international content, which is a plus for global viewers.

Hulu: Hulu is famous for having the most up-to-date TV shows. If you enjoy watching episodes the day after they air, Hulu is a great choice. Hulu also has a strong collection of movies and exclusive originals.

Disney+: Disney+ is perfect for fans of Disney, Marvel, Star Wars, and Pixar. While it may not have as broad a selection of non-franchise content, it offers everything from classic Disney movies to the latest Marvel blockbusters.

Comparison: While Pikachu App offers a good variety of content, it may not match the quantity and exclusive offerings found on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, or Disney+. However, it is a solid choice for users looking for something different, especially with its live TV feature.

2. User Interface and Experience

A good streaming app should have an intuitive interface that is easy to navigate. Let’s break down the user experience on the Pikachu App compared to other platforms:

Pikachu App: The Pikachu App has a clean and simple interface, making it easy for new users to find and watch content. The app has a well-organized homepage, and the search feature is straightforward. However, the design may not be as sleek or polished as some of the bigger streaming platforms.

Netflix: Netflix offers a user-friendly interface with smooth navigation. The home screen displays personalized recommendations based on your viewing habits. The search feature is effective, and the app supports multiple user profiles.

Amazon Prime Video: Amazon’s interface is functional but can sometimes feel cluttered due to the variety of content it offers. The search feature is efficient, and like Netflix, it suggests content based on your preferences.

Hulu: Hulu’s interface is similar to Netflix’s in terms of layout, but it is designed to focus more on TV shows and next-day episodes. The interface is user-friendly, though it lacks the sophistication of Netflix.

Disney+: Disney+ has a clean, family-friendly design. It organizes content by franchises (Marvel, Star Wars, etc.), making it easy to find content for specific interests.

Comparison: The Pikachu App offers a simple user experience, which is great for those who prefer no-frills navigation. However, platforms like Netflix and Amazon Prime Video have more polished interfaces with additional features like personalized recommendations and multiple user profiles.

3. Streaming Quality

Streaming quality is another crucial factor to consider. Whether you’re watching a high-definition movie or a live sports game, the picture and sound quality must be top-notch.

Pikachu App: The Pikachu App supports HD streaming, and depending on your internet connection, you can enjoy smooth viewing. However, the app may not support 4K streaming, which is becoming more common in other streaming services.

Netflix: Netflix offers HD, 4K, and even HDR streaming for supported content. This makes Netflix one of the best options for high-quality streaming.

Amazon Prime Video: Amazon also supports HD and 4K streaming for many of its titles. Prime Video provides solid picture quality, but it may not always match Netflix’s consistency in streaming performance.

Hulu: Hulu offers HD streaming, but it lacks 4K support, which may be a disadvantage for those with 4K TVs.

Disney+: Disney+ supports HD and 4K streaming, especially for its big-budget movies like those from the Marvel and Star Wars franchises.

Comparison: In terms of streaming quality, Netflix and Amazon Prime Video lead the pack with 4K and HDR support. The Pikachu App provides solid HD quality but may lag behind in offering the highest resolutions.

4. Price and Subscription Plans

When choosing a streaming app, the price is always a major consideration. Let’s compare the pricing structure of the Pikachu App with the other services:Pikachu App: The Pikachu App offers a free version with ads and a premium version with additional features like ad-free streaming and exclusive content. The premium version is affordable, making it an attractive option for budget-conscious users.

Netflix: Netflix has several subscription tiers, including Basic, Standard, and Premium. Prices vary depending on the plan and region. The most expensive plan offers 4K streaming and multiple simultaneous streams.

Amazon Prime Video: Prime Video is included with an Amazon Prime membership, which also gives access to benefits like free shipping on Amazon. The cost is higher than a standalone streaming service, but it includes many additional perks.

Hulu: Hulu offers several pricing tiers, including an ad-supported plan, an ad-free plan, and a bundle that includes Disney+ and ESPN+. Hulu’s pricing is competitive, especially for TV show lovers.

Disney+: Disney+ offers a single subscription plan that is relatively affordable. It also has bundles with Hulu and ESPN+, which offer better value for families or sports fans.

Comparison: The Pikachu App offers one of the most affordable subscription plans compared to other streaming services. While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, and Hulu offer various pricing options, Pikachu’s free and premium choices make it an accessible option for many users.

  1. Device Compatibility

Streaming apps should be compatible with a wide range of devices. Let’s look at the device compatibility of the Pikachu App:

Pikachu App: The Pikachu App is available on smartphones, tablets, and smart TVs. It supports both Android and iOS devices, making it easy for most users to access content.

Netflix: Netflix is compatible with almost every device, including smartphones, tablets, smart TVs, game consoles, and even some set-top boxes.

Amazon Prime Video: Prime Video is available on a variety of devices, including smartphones, tablets, smart TVs, and streaming devices like Roku and Fire TV.

Hulu: Hulu works on most devices, including smartphones, tablets, smart TVs, and gaming consoles.

Disney+: Disney+ is available on a wide range of devices, including smartphones, tablets, smart TVs, and game consoles.

Comparison: The Pikachu App supports a wide range of devices, though it may not have as many compatibility options as Netflix or Amazon Prime Video. However, it is still sufficient for most users’ needs.

  1. Unique Features

Each streaming app has its own set of unique features that set it apart from the competition. Let’s explore the Pikachu App’s special features:

Pikachu App: The Pikachu App offers live TV streaming, which is not commonly found in many other apps. It also provides content from various genres, including sports, which appeals to a broader audience.

Netflix: Netflix offers a massive library of original content, such as movies, TV shows, and documentaries. It also allows users to download content for offline viewing.

Amazon Prime Video: Amazon offers features like X-Ray, which gives users information about actors and trivia during playback. It also allows users to rent or buy movies that are not included with the subscription.

Hulu: Hulu offers next-day access to TV shows, which is perfect for viewers who want to catch up on episodes as soon as they air. It also allows for live TV streaming.

Disney+: Disney+ offers exclusive access to Disney, Marvel, Star Wars, and Pixar content. It also has a feature called GroupWatch, which allows users to watch content together remotely.

Comparison: The Pikachu App’s live TV feature is unique, offering something different from what many other streaming services provide. However, services like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, and Disney+ focus heavily on exclusive original content.

Conclusion

The Pikachu App is a great choice for users looking for an affordable, user-friendly streaming service with a variety of content. While it may not have the extensive libraries or high-end features of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, or Disney+, it offers solid performance, ease of use, and an attractive price point. Depending on your preferences for content, streaming quality, and device compatibility, the Pikachu App can be a strong competitor in the streaming world.

When choosing between Pikachu and other streaming services, it’s essential to consider your personal viewing habits. If you’re looking for the latest movies and TV shows, Netflix or Amazon Prime Video might be a better fit. But if you want a more budget-friendly option with live TV streaming and a good variety of content, the Pikachu App could be the right choice for you.
